Senior Consultant - Data & AI
Microsoft
Microsoft Industry Solutions - Global Center for Innovation and Delivery Center (GCID) delivers end-to-end solutions by enabling accelerated adoption and productive use of Microsoft technologies. An organization of well over 2000+ exceptional people, GCID presents a great opportunity for highly skilled services professionals to make a foray into consulting, solution development and delivery roles. The ideal consultant is passionate about technology, has breadth rather than specific product depth, and has the drive and courage to articulate and stand up for a great solution delivering true value for the client.
As a Senior Data & AI Consultant, you will design and deliver modern, cloud-native and AI-powered data solutions that drive measurable business outcomes, deliver quality engagements with your expertise, either as an advisor, reviewer, or contributor in high profile projects to ensure customer value. The ideal candidate must have the ability to combine their technical skills, leadership skills, creativity, and customer focus to deliver great solutions to the customers and ensure they get the best out of our technologies and solutions. Consulting Delivery professionals bring subject matter and solution expertise to architectural teams, customers, and partners. They apply deep technical and business knowledge to accelerate the adoption of Microsoft devices and services by ensuring strategic, architectural, and operational alignment to customer and partner objectives.
Responsibilities
Lead technical delivery of complex, cloud native and AI enabled engagements, contributing as a hands-on individual contributor and, where required, leading engineering teams to ensure high-quality, predictable outcomes.
Define and drive the technology strategy for large and complex customer engagements, ensuring solutions are scalable, secure, compliant, and aligned to business objectives, architectural best practices, and Microsoft reference architectures.
Design, develop, and deploy solutions on Microsoft Azure, accelerating customer value through the effective use of Microsoft technologies, platforms, and delivery methodologies while meeting quality, time, and cost constraints.
Identifies the best practice approach for a project, across a wide scope of technical issues, and develops or reuses intellectual capital (IP) with customers, world-wide, and programs and initiatives across Microsoft.
Identifies dependencies and risks that go beyond the immediate scope and timeframe for a complex project. Develops contingency plans, risk-mitigation implementation criteria, and alternative strategies to manage short- and long-term risks and manages technical escalations.
Collaborates, as appropriate, with peers and cross-functional teams to scale the business with existing high-stake or strategic customers, by articulating/developing value propositions for strategic Microsoft products and services.
Drives AI-First data engineering principles and mindset in the team to make the best of AI tools and services while helping in orchestration, transformation, and operationalization of AI/ML-powered data solutions.
Continuously upskill self to become strong Full stack data engineer, inspire their team as much, to be able to build future-ready skills, collaborate with other specialist teams, product teams, and customers to co-create innovative solutions and help the customers tackle some of their biggest challenges.
Drives new ways of thinking, across the division and subsidiary, to improve quality, engineering productivity, and responsiveness to feedback and changing priorities.
Implement rapid prototyping and able to lead from brainstorming and whiteboarding ideas to production-ready solutions driven by AI-first mindset. Upskill consistently to get better in this and deliver innovation for customers using Azure stacks.
Qualifications
Qualifications
10+ years of experience
Bachelor's degree in computer science engineering or equivalent work experience. Higher relevant education is preferred.
Customer facing Project delivery leadership experience involving solution design, project envisioning, planning, development and deployment of complex solutions with minimum of 5 plus years.
One or more of the following certifications, or other industry equivalent ones, is a plus:
Microsoft Certified: Fabric Analytics Engineer Associate (DP600)
Microsoft Certified: Azure AI Engineer Associate (AI102)
Microsoft Certified: Azure Solution Architect Expert (AZ-305)
Areas of Expertise
Data Architecture & Platform Engineering
Lead enterprise data architecture/design across cloud, on-prem, and hybrid environments, designing scalable Data Warehouse, Lakehouse, and analytics platforms using Microsoft Fabric, Azure Synapse Analytics. Knowledge of Azure Databricks is a plus
Architect modern platforms using Azure Data Services, serverless and microservices architectures, including largescale data migrations, platform modernization, and multitenant, security hardened designs
Apply deep expertise across OLTP/OLAP, columnar, opensource, and NoSQL databases (e.g., Cosmos DB, Redis, Cassandra, MongoDB) with strong governance and access control models
AI-First Delivery
Embed AI first principles across solution design, delivery workflows, automation, and intelligent orchestration for complex data and AI enabled programs
Own end-to-end technical execution—architecture decisions, engineering standards, quality, compliance, and delivery governance—aligning solutions to business outcomes
Help define delivery strategies, milestones, risk mitigation, recovery paths, and adoption of AI native delivery models (MLOps, intelligent pipelines)
Engineering Excellence & DataOps
Champion high quality engineering practices including coding standards, architectural integrity, performance benchmarks, security, testing, observability, and optimization
Drive Data Ops and DevOps excellence using Agile methodologies, Azure DevOps, CI/CD, and automation
Promote reuse through accelerators, reference architectures, shared components, and continuous learning via certifications and emerging platforms
AI / ML & Intelligent Systems
Lead AI powered data engineering, ML ready pipelines, and operationalized MLOps using Azure AI services
Apply hands-on expertise in Python, deep learning/Gen AI frameworks (PyTorch, TensorFlow), orchestration frameworks like LangChain/LangGraph, prompt engineering, RAG frameworks, AI Search, and agentic workflows on Azure AI stack
Integrate AI into enterprise data platforms, enabling intelligent automation and applying Responsible AI principles (fairness, governance, security, compliance, interpretability)
Innovation & Technical Thought Leadership
Apply design thinking and user centric approaches to deliver high impact data and AI solutions
Track and influence emerging technologies, delivery models, and platform strategy
Build and share intellectual property (IP), reusable assets, and best practices to improve delivery predictability, quality, and efficiency
Team Leadership & Mentorship
Lead and mentor engineering teams, fostering collaboration, technical excellence, and accountability
Provide guidance through design and code reviews, coaching, and feedback
Support professional development and build a strong, inclusive engineering culture
Soft Skills & Mindset
Strong communication and presentation skills with the ability to engage both technical and non-technical stakeholders.
Passion for mentoring, knowledge sharing, and continuous learning.
Proven adaptability to new technologies and evolving customer requirements.
Experience working in Agile/Scrum environments.
Awareness of AI technologies and their integration into cloud solutions.
Good to have:
Customer Co-Innovation Mindset & Customer Enablement
Lead rapid prototyping, pilots, and early-stage production deployments for enterprise customers, accelerating time-to-value
Translate from whiteboard to production with minimal friction, engineering alongside customer teams to unblock delivery and adoption
Own troubleshooting across performance, reliability, cost, security, and data quality, delivering outcome-driven engineering in ambiguous, high-pressure environments
This position will be open for a minimum of 5 days, with applications accepted on an ongoing basis until the position is filled.
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ances. If you need assistance with religious accommodations and/or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ations.